当没有git密码时无法访问MySQL数据库的问题,可能是由于缺少权限或配置错误导致的。以下是一个完善且全面的答案:
问题描述:
当没有git密码时无法访问MySQL数据库。
解决方案:
- 检查MySQL用户权限:确保使用的MySQL用户具有足够的权限来访问数据库。可以通过以下命令检查用户权限:SHOW GRANTS FOR 'username'@'localhost';如果权限不足,可以使用以下命令为用户授予访问数据库的权限:GRANT ALL PRIVILEGES ON database_name.* TO 'username'@'localhost';其中,'database_name'是要访问的数据库名称,'username'是MySQL用户。
- 检查MySQL配置文件:确保MySQL配置文件中的相关配置正确。可以通过以下步骤进行检查:
- 打开MySQL配置文件(通常是my.cnf或my.ini)。
- 检查以下配置项是否正确设置:[client]
user = your_username
password = your_password其中,'your_username'是MySQL用户名,'your_password'是对应的密码。
- 检查git配置文件:确保git配置文件中的MySQL连接信息正确。可以通过以下步骤进行检查:
- 打开.git/config文件。
- 检查以下配置项是否正确设置:[remote "origin"]
url = mysql://username:password@localhost/database_name其中,'username'是MySQL用户名,'password'是对应的密码,'database_name'是要访问的数据库名称。
- 检查网络连接:确保能够正常连接到MySQL数据库的网络。可以通过以下步骤进行检查:
- 确保MySQL服务器正在运行。
- 检查网络连接是否正常,例如防火墙是否阻止了MySQL的访问。
推荐的腾讯云相关产品和产品介绍链接地址:
请注意,以上答案仅供参考,具体解决方案可能因实际情况而异。在实际操作中,请根据具体情况进行调整和验证。